This role supports Senior Accountable Site Person (MD) and site leadership (Execs) in day-to-day implementation of Diageo’s Occupational, Health & Safety policy, programs and site priorities.Top Accountabilities
Assist in the formulation and drive delivery of the OH&S KPIs that will drive a continuous improvement culture within DSA demand towards delivery of Safety Excellence and a Zero Harm culture. Work with site resources to develop and deliver programmes that aid compliance for DSA against legislation and Diageo StandardsSetting targets to drive improvements with regard to the areas above across DSA demand and reporting same to Governance Manager and the DSA Health & Safety Steering Group.Track performance and provide insights into drivers of performance on a monthly basisTaking a lead role in driving the required culture, including employee education and engagement.Implement LTO Emergency Response systemProvide support to the Local Crises TeamProvide Induction and refresher training, Process Training and co-ordinate mandatory training requirements for staff, visitors and contractors. Deliver fit for purpose risk training to all employee groups across ISCAudit facilities and systems according to LTO Audit GuidelinesMaintain all Safety / Security related schedules and Action PlansInspectionsRisk AssessmentsMaintain Minutes and follow up actions of Safety Committees Support Incident Investigation including root cause analyses and implementation of preventative measures,Maintain Incident and CIRC (prevention & Compliance System) RegistersMaintenance, compilation and trending of relevant documentation.Monthly reports / KPI’sSupport HR with Mandatory COID (Workman’s Compensation)processesEnsure the Occ Health requirements are implemented .Medical Screening etcSupport Facility Manager with all Physical Facility RequirementsExperience / skills required :
